Web28 sep. 2024 · How long before bed should you take Lunesta? Lunesta is meant to be taken by mouth right before bed. Before taking Lunesta, a person should have at least seven or eight hours of available sleep time. It’s important to go straight to bed right after taking the drug. I cycle between 12-25mg Seroquel, 1.8-3.5mg mirtazapine and 1-3mg lunesta. dnp idw500 id media mismatchWeb8 nov. 2013 · Take Lunesta right before you get into bed. Do not take Lunesta with, or right after a high-fat meal. Do not take Lunesta unless you are able to get a full night's sleep before you must be active again. Call your doctor if your insomnia worsens or is not better within 7 to 10 days.
